Vodafone hits back at Reding

time August 31st, 2008 by author David Goldstein

Vodafone has vented its anger at Viviane Reding by making the extraordinary claim that 40m Europeans could be forced to ditch their mobile phones because of the European commissioner’s controversial plan for telecoms reform.

Ms Reding is provoking a bitter fight with leading mobile operators over her plan for deep cuts in the charges they impose on each other, together with fixed-line phone companies, for connecting calls to their wireless networks.
